In other words, do not rely solely on the Left Arm to Pull itself through the Ball. Except in the shortest Strokes, Swinging is all about transferring the rotating Body's momentum into the 'essentially inert' Left Arm and Club. You're absolutely correct that the Right Forearm and #3 Pressure Point are the ones responsible for keeping the Club 'on track' through Impact, and their absence forfeits a substantial control. However, using a little Pivot to help you through will go a long way toward eliminating those one-arm fat and thin shots. I was doing the left arm drill last night at the range with my SW.
